UK government is exploring various options regarding British Steel's future, with a focus on potential partnerships, including Chinese investment. Minister Sarah Jones emphasized the aim to maintain and grow steel production in the UK, countering a trend of decline. Business Secretary Jonathan Reynolds asserted that ensuring the availability of raw materials is key for British Steel's future, indicating a strong correlation between the steel industry and the UK's infrastructure projects, which are anticipated to boost demand significantly as part of a national renewal strategy.
